The Outsider Art Fair opened at Center 548 in Chelsea with three floors of unconventional drawings, paintings, sculpture, found object assemblages and more. Inventive use of unexpected materials seemed to be a theme throughout the fair. Found object sculpture and small works were especially compelling. Both the hand and the psyche of the artist were emphasized in the majority of works, creating an intimate interaction between artist and viewer. Overall, individuality seemed to be what was most celebrated by this fair, and the result was refreshing and thought-provoking. BASIC INFO: Outsider Art Fair 2015 remains on view through February 1 at Center 548. Center 548 is located at 548 West 22nd street, New York, NY 10011. www.outsiderartfair.com.
